Vision is the result of light being detected and transduced into neural signals by the retina of the eye. This information is then further analyzed and interpreted by the brain. First, light enters the front of the eye and is focused by the cornea and lens onto the retina—a thin sheet of neural tissue lining the back of the eye. Because of refraction through the convex lens of the eye, images are projected onto the retina upside-down and reversed.

Light enters the eye through the cornea, a transparent, dome-shaped surface covering the surface of the eyeball that helps to direct and focus incoming light. This light is then channeled toward the pupil, an adjustable opening whose size is controlled by the iris. The iris, a pigmented muscle, regulates the amount of light entering the eye by contracting or dilating the pupil, thereby ensuring optimal light levels for clear vision.

The brain processes sensory information rapidly due to parallel processing, which involves sending data across multiple neural pathways at the same time. This method allows the brain to manage various sensory qualities, such as shapes, colors, movements, and locations, all concurrently. For instance, when observing a forest landscape, the brain simultaneously processes the movement of leaves, the shapes of trees, the depth between them, and the various shades of green. 背景情况:

  • 从上向下调制对于将感官处理集中在与任务相关的信息上至关重要.
  • 额叶皮质在调节感官区域方面发挥着作用,但具体的机制尚未完全理解.

研究的目的:

  • 调查环带皮层 (Cg) 对初级视觉皮层 (V1) 感官处理的影响.
  • 阐明Cg介导上下调节的基础细胞和电路机制.

主要方法:

  • 利用光遗传学来激活Cg神经元及其在V1.1中的投射.
  • 记录V1神经元反应和评估视觉区分性能.
  • 研究了特定的GABAergic内部神经元亚型 (体静止素阳性和血管活性肠阳性) 的作用.

主要成果:

  • 环状皮层的激活增强了V1神经元的反应,改善了视觉歧视.
  • 焦点Cg轴突激活在V1诱导的中心-周围调制:响应增加在网站和周围地区的减少.
  • 索马托他他阳性内部神经元调解了周围抑制,而血管活性肠阳性内部神经元则调解了中心促进.

结论:

  • 带带皮层的远距离投射有力调节初级视觉皮层活动.
  • 这种调节是通过在V1.1内激活局部GABAergic微电路来实现的.
  • 这些发现揭示了涉及不同内部神经元群体的感官处理的特定空间上下控制机制.
